Marketing 101 in South Carolina

March 15, 2012Posted by Eric Granofin News

In our continued support of local bail agent associations, the AIA Team travelled to Florence, South Carolina this past week to both sponsor and present at the South Carolina Bail Agents’ Association meeting. AIA’s Chief Marketing Officer, Eric Granof, spoke with agents about a topic that is extremely important in the bail bond industry, Marketing. From yellow pages to websites and Facebook to Twitter, the agents in attendance learned how marketing has evolved over the years and how now more than ever, they need to evolve their own marketing if they want to remain competitive in a hyper competitive marketplace. According to a recent study conducted by Google, 75% of small businesses in South Carolina don’t even have a web page. “Not having a web presence in today’s business environment is flat out crazy,” said Granof to the group. “It is the equivalent of trying to get customers to come in your store without having a door for them to walk through.”

As part of our ongoing efforts to educate agents on the value and ins and outs of marketing a bail business, we are launching a new whitepaper series on the subject of Marketing.
